Abstract

The aim of this study is to investigate the activation of NF-κB signaling pathway and the regulation of the expression of genes related to chorionic villus growth by the binding of LncRNA MTC (XLOC_005914) and p65 (transcription factor p65 [Capra hircus], XP_017898873.1). In addition, the regulation of LncRNA MTC and p65 binding on the proliferation of Liaoning Cashmere Goat skin fibroblasts is investigated. The upregulation of LncRNA MTC promoted the proliferation of skin fibroblasts, and the NF-κB signaling pathway played an important role in this process. Compared with the negative control (NC group), the expression of TNFα and NFKB2(NF-κB) genes was highly significantly up-regulated (P < 0.001), and NFKBIA(IκBɑ) genes were highly significantly down-regulated (P < 0.01) after LncRNA MTC overexpression (OE group). The expression levels of TNFα and NFκB-P-p65 proteins were upregulated in the OE group; NF-κB-p65 expression levels were upregulated in the nucleus, IκBα expression levels were downregulated in the cytoplasm, and P-IκBα expression levels were upregulated. LncRNA MTC and p65 proteins were co-localized in the cells. Meanwhile, LncRNA MTC and p65 protein showed significant nucleation in the OE group. RNA pull-down and LC-MS/MS verified that p65 protein was indeed an interacting protein of LncRNA MTC. LncRNA MTC binds to p65 protein, upregulates the expression of TNFα protein, nucleates p65 protein, and activates NF-κB signaling pathway to promote the proliferation of skin fibroblasts in Liaoning Cashmere Goat.
